I poured through a tea strainer to catch any plant material. The drink has a dark reddish brown colour, and there's an aroma which has a definite cannabis profile, also somehow medicinal. It tastes surprisingly mellow, but with a fiery after kick. It's a bit like these medicinal liqueurs you get in Switzerland and Austria. Definitely a sipper not a quaffer. I'll report back later on any effects that might arise from the cannabis infusion. Well the drink got me well and truly blasted. I had the equivalent of two double measures of spirits, but I estimate the liqueur started out at around 30% ABV, not sure what chemical processes resulted from eight months (!) of steeping cannabis in it, but may have reduced alcohol content slightly. The main effect after sipping slowly over around an hour was to make me really sleepy, and a bit unsteady on my feet when I moved about. Certainly way more powerful than just straight booze would be. I slept really well! On the down side it doesn't taste too great, and left my tongue coated with an residue that tasted of chlorophyll and AVB. Some fizzy water and a boiled sweet banished that. This liqueur could probably substitute for various "bitters" when mixing a cocktail. In future I think I will treat it more like Jägermeister or similar, drink from a small shot glass rather than trying to enjoy it like brandy or whisky. But yeah, it works.
